Output 422069984ed62f115fa8c2976eafbb23cb78eef635da1e7878d507ddd7fd8a5c:1

value
44952000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df504c23b46fd01756d10cf858d4ee1be4c5dc0c OP_EQUAL
address
ACo3YL7vfP3jWVPcHriBRo7HmnNB19iNdp
transaction
422069984ed62f115fa8c2976eafbb23cb78eef635da1e7878d507ddd7fd8a5c